If the Glove Fits

Simpson was tried for the murders of both Brown and Goldman. After a nine-month trial, Simpson was acquitted. However, in a 1997 civil trial, he was found liable for their deaths and awarded $19.5 million in damages to their respective families. Simpson maintained his innocence, but he still authored a book, infamous for its title: If I Did It.
